工作中常用SQL代码整理

本文整理了工作中常用的SQL代码,包括利用时间运算、分区排序进行数据处理,使用substring和substr函数截取字段,利用UNION替代OR语句,以及在不同数据库中实现LIKE操作的方法。还涉及到了报表统计、数值转换、字符串拼接与替换,以及在没有数据时的默认值处理等实用技巧。

1.引用现在的时间且用于时间运算:

(now()::timestamp)::date -("日期"::timestamp)::date) =1

2.分区排序,用于查找第n次出现的东东,还可以用于去重

select row_number() over
评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值